I have a number of old 486's that were on some type of network,that I'm trying to refurbish... Thing is every thing goes fine till I try to execute a progie from floppy. I get a pop-up saying this program canceled because of restrictions in place on this computer. I used Killcmos to remove any passwords and set floppy access to "user",then I reformated and reinstalled windows95 with the bios set for user access to floppy but still got the same thing...

Check and make sure that the floppy drives haven't been hooked up using the "B" connectors on the cable. We used to do this in a classroom so the kiddies wouldn't load viruses on the workstations.

You must use Poledit to remove the restrictions. It is on the install CD
